What happens if no audience is selected for a recommendation?

Study for the Experience Cloud Certification Exam. Enhance your knowledge with flashcards and multiple-choice questions, featuring hints and explanations. Get ready to excel in your exam!

When no audience is selected for a recommendation, it means that there are no specific criteria limiting who can view that recommendation. In this case, all members of the site will see the recommendation because the absence of restrictions allows it to be displayed universally. This design is intentional, allowing administrators to ensure that important recommendations can be viewed by all users without needing to set specific audience parameters.
